个人简介

林嘉平,华东理工大学特聘教授、博士生导师。1986年、1989年上海交通大学本科、硕士毕业,1993年华东化工学院博士毕业,1993年6月至1995年6月日本东京工业大学博士后研究(获得日本学术振兴会博士后基金),1995年6月至1997年8月奥地利林茨大学博士后研究(获得奥地利科学基金会的Lise-Meitner基金)。1997年回国在华东理工大学任教至今。任华东理工大学学术、学位委员会委员,国务院学位委员会第7、8届学科评议组(材料科学与工程组)成员、中国材料研究学会理事、中国化学会高分子学科委员会委员、中国化学会应用化学学科委员会委员、英国皇家化学会会士。任Macromolecules(2014-2017)、J. Mater. Chem. A(2014-2017)、ACS Macro Lett.(2014-2017)、 Polymer International、Scientific Reports、高分子学报、高分子材料科学与工程等刊物的编委以及功能高分子学报主编。

研究领域

主要从事高分子理论模拟、高分子材料基因组、高分子自组装和生物医用高分子的研究
